引言
随着大数据时代的到来,数据已成为企业决策的重要依据。数据建模作为一种有效的方法,能够帮助我们更好地理解数据,从中提取有价值的信息。在众多数据建模方法中,维度范式宽表因其高效的数据处理能力和强大的分析潜能而备受关注。本文将深入探讨维度范式宽表的特点、优势以及在实际应用中的实施方法。
一、什么是维度范式宽表?
维度范式宽表是一种数据存储格式,它将数据按照维度和事实进行组织,通过扩展行来容纳更多的数据字段。与传统的关系型数据库相比,维度范式宽表具有以下特点:
- 宽表:每个记录包含大量的字段,可以容纳更多维度的信息。
- 维度:维度是指数据中用来描述事物特征的属性,如时间、地区、产品等。
- 事实:事实是指数据中的具体数值,如销售额、访问量等。
二、维度范式宽表的优势
- 数据整合:宽表可以将不同来源的数据整合到一个表中,便于统一管理和分析。
- 提高查询效率:宽表可以通过减少数据访问路径来提高查询效率。
- 简化数据处理:宽表可以减少数据转换和清洗的工作量,提高数据处理效率。
- 支持复杂分析:宽表可以容纳更多的维度和事实,便于进行复杂的数据分析。
三、维度范式宽表的实施方法
- 数据源分析:首先,需要对数据源进行详细分析,确定所需的维度和事实。
- 设计宽表结构:根据数据源分析结果,设计宽表的结构,包括字段类型、长度等。
- 数据加载:将数据从源系统加载到宽表中,包括数据清洗、转换和整合等步骤。
- 数据质量管理:对宽表中的数据进行质量管理,确保数据的准确性和一致性。
- 数据分析:利用宽表进行数据分析,提取有价值的信息,为决策提供支持。
四、案例分析
以下是一个使用维度范式宽表进行数据分析的案例:
案例背景
某电商平台希望通过分析用户购买行为,了解不同产品的销售趋势。
实施步骤
- 数据源分析:确定需要分析的维度和事实,如用户ID、产品ID、购买时间、销售额等。
- 设计宽表结构:根据分析结果,设计宽表结构,包括用户ID、产品ID、购买时间、销售额等字段。
- 数据加载:将用户购买数据加载到宽表中,包括数据清洗、转换和整合等步骤。
- 数据质量管理:对宽表中的数据进行质量管理,确保数据的准确性和一致性。
- 数据分析:利用宽表进行数据分析,了解不同产品的销售趋势。
分析结果
通过分析,发现以下趋势:
- 某款产品在特定时间段内销售量明显增加。
- 某个地区的用户购买力较强。
- 某类产品的用户群体较为集中。
五、总结
维度范式宽表作为一种高效的数据存储和分析方法,具有诸多优势。在实际应用中,我们需要根据具体需求设计宽表结构,并对数据进行质量管理,才能充分发挥其潜能。随着大数据时代的不断发展,维度范式宽表将在数据建模领域发挥越来越重要的作用。
